Battle-tested Kearney football readies for another tough season in Class A
KEARNEY, Neb. (KSNB) - The Kearney Bearcats football team made the playoff in both 2022 and 2023, but each time were eliminated in the first round. With plenty of returning starters Kearney is aiming to make a deeper playoff run this year. The Bearcats return key pieces such as starting quarterback Griffin Novacek and Kansas State commit, linebacker Sawyer Schilke.

City considers street plan, aquaculture facility
NEBRASKA CITY – The Nebraska City City Council is scheduled to meet at 6 p.m on Aug. 19. The agenda includes public hearings on a $1 million loan from the Nebraska City Economic Growth Funds to Goodlife Agriculture for an aquaculture facility at 6219 G Road, rezoning of the north industrial site and blight and substandard redevelopment area 6. A forgivable loan agreement is proposed.
